HNA Hotels & Resorts Plans To Buy Two Hotels In Shanghai Xintiandi
HNA Hotels & Resorts is planning to acquire Jumeirah HanTang Xintiandi and Conrad Shanghai, two luxury hotels in Shanghai Xintiandi, the construction of both of which has been stopped due to the financial crisis.

Accor Opens First Pullman Hotel In Shanghai
Accor has opened its first Pullman hotel in Shanghai, the Pullman Shanghai Skyway, which is located in the affluent Lu Wan district.
Guangzhou's Old Five-star Hotels Spend Big Money On Renovation
In face of competition imposed by newly-opened five star hotels, time-honored five-star hotels in Guangzhou have each begun to spend large sums on transformation and renovation.
